          Originally posted by Mini Me
          Hi Barry, I have a Hind 24 D enroute for the GB......I was wondering what color you used for the cockpit interior, as I saw no reference to it in the text. Really like the 3D decals.....looks the "bomb". :thumb2: Rick H.
          It is Russian Interior Turquoise. MRP001. I always spray MRP.

                                #45
                                The painting is just about done.

                                I will apply the decals straight onto the paint and then the washes before applying a matt coat.
